The Mystery Behind Nelzon: Meaning and Origin
When researching Nelzon, one thing becomes clear—this name is a bit of a mystery. Unlike classic names like Elizabeth or Michael, which have well-documented meanings and origins, Nelzon's roots are unknown. It doesn't appear in the usual baby name dictionaries or linguistic sources. This rarity makes Nelzon fascinating; it's like a blank canvas for parents and individuals to craft their own meaning and story.
The name resembles 'Nelson,' a name with English origins meaning "son of Neil," but Nelzon itself doesn't have any verified connection. It could be a modern invention or a creative variation, blending the familiar with the novel.
